Henry Hub Natural Gas Spot Prices 2005 |
|
Spot prices reached their peak on Friday, reflecting the impact of the uncertainty caused by Hurricane Dennis. Storm-related shut-ins have reduced gas production in the Gulf of Mexico and, combined with high temperatures, have pressured spot prices upward. As of July 13, the Minerals Management Service reported that 1.03 billion cubic feet per day of natural gas production still remains shut in. For the week (Wednesday to Wednesday), the spot price at the Henry Hub rose 10 cents, or 1.3 percent, to $7.78 per million British thermal units (mmBtu). The Henry Hub price was $1.94, or 33 percent, above last year's level of $5.84. |
